Robert Roberson, a soul woven into the very fabric of those fortunate enough to know him, departed from this earthly realm on January 2, 2026, leaving behind a legacy of love, care, and kindness. Born on October 20, 1947, Robert embraced life with a fervor that inspired many. His heart was a sanctuary of warmth, filled with an unwavering love for his family and friends.
A devoted husband, Robert spent countless hours relishing moments alongside his wife, crafting memories that would last well beyond their time together. He cherished each gathering, embracing the laughter and joy shared within the walls of his home. Family was both his anchor and his delight, and he moved through life with a profound sense of gratitude for those relationships.
Robert was a devout Christian who poured his heart into his church community. His presence enlivened gatherings, as he found solace in the camaraderie of shared faith and purpose, lifting those around him with his loving spirit. He was also a sports enthusiast, his spirit mirroring the passion he felt for each game and event.
As his loved ones gather to celebrate this remarkable man, a viewing will be held on January 19, 2026, from 12:00 PM to 4:00 PM at Golden Gate Funeral Home in Fort Worth, Texas. The following day, on January 20, family and friends will convene at East Saint Paul Baptist Church at 11:00 AM to honor Robert's memory and the indelible marks he etched upon their lives.
In every act of kindness, every joyful cheer at a sporting event, and every moment spent in the company of loved ones, Robert's legacy will soar on. Though his earthly journey has come to a close, the impact of his unwavering love and compassionate spirit will resonate eternally within the hearts of those he leaves behind.
